Total Visits

Views
The ... 241

Total Visits Per Month

October 2024November 2024December 2024January 2025February 2025March 2025April 2025
The ... 30 6 6 1 5 10 0

Top country views

Views
United States 139
China 14
Australia 13
Germany 12
Ireland 12
Singapore 11
United Kingdom 8
Egypt 7
Nigeria 4
Qatar 4

Top cities views

Views
Ashburn 21
Dublin 12
Ann Arbor 9
Oakland 9
Boardman 6
Giza 6
Sherman Oaks 6
Abeokuta 4
Fairfield 4
Shenzhen 4